Letters to John Murray, publishers, of Hariot Hamilton-Temple-Blackwood., 1862-1918.

 File
Identifier: MS.40108
Scope and Contents Letters, 1862-1918, of Hariot Hamilton-Temple-Blackwood to John Murray III, John Murray IV, and Hallam Murray, with related letters and papers. They concern works of hers published by the Murrays, including “Our viceregal life in India: selections from my journal” and “My Canadian journal 1872-8”. Later letters discuss the biography of her husband by Alfred Lyall, and also the impact of the First World War on her family. The letters are arranged in chronological order.1862:...
Dates: 1862-1918.

Letters to John Murray, publishers, of Mountstuart Grant Duff., 1862-1898.

 File
Identifier: MS.40348
Scope and Contents Letters, 1862-1898, of Mountstuart Grant Duff to John Murray IV and Hallam Murray, with a few to John Murray III, with related letters and papers. They mostly concern his work on “Notes from a diary”, published by the Murrays.
